出 处:《沈阳药科大学学报》2020年第2期131-135,共5页Journal of Shenyang Pharmaceutical University
摘 要:目的建立复方木鸡颗粒中4种成分(金雀花碱、苦参碱、槐果碱和槲皮苷)含量的高效液相色谱法测定方法。方法采用Waters Xselect T3 C18(250 mm×4.6 mm,5μm)色谱柱;流动相为磷酸盐缓冲液(pH 6.8)-三乙胺(体积比70∶0.1)(A)-乙腈(B)-甲醇(C)进行梯度洗脱;流速1.0 mL·min-1,柱温30℃,检测波长220 nm。结果 4种成分的分离度良好,且在各自浓度范围内呈现出良好的线性关系。金雀花碱、苦参碱、槐果碱和槲皮苷在进样质量浓度分别为2.0~32.0、9.0~144.0、5.0~80.0和4.0~64.0 mg·L-1内呈良好线性关系,相关系数r≥0.999 0,平均回收率在95.3%~103.2%,RSD为3.8%~4.8%(n=9)。含量测定结果显示,3种生物碱和槲皮苷在不同批次中的含量比较稳定。结论该法简便、准确,分离效果好,可用于复方木鸡颗粒的多成分同时测定,为复方木鸡颗粒的质量控制提供方法参考。Objective To establish an HPLC method to simultaneously determine the contents of sophorine,matrine,sophocarpine and quercitrin in Fufang Muji granules,in order to provide basis for studying its quality standards.Methods An HPLC method was developed.Waters Xselect T3 C18 column(4.6 mm×250 mm,5 μm) was used and eluted with mobile phase of acetonitrile-methanol-phosphate buffer(pH6.8) at the flow rate of 1.0 mL·min-1.The wavelength was set at 220 nm.The column temperature was maintained at 30 ℃.Results The good linear relationships between the concentration and peak area were in the range of 2.0-32.0 mg·L-1 for cytosine,5.0-80.0 mg·L-1 for matrine,9.0-144.0 mg·L-1 for matrine and 4.0-64.0 mg·L-1 for quercitrin(r≥0.999 0),respectively.The average recoveries(n=9) were in the range of 95.3%-103.2% and RSD were in the range of 3.8%~4.8%.Conclusion The method is simple,feasible and reproducible and can be used for the quality control of Fufang Muji Granules.
